Free national news station airing mental health programming in September

Newsy, a free, 24/7 national news network, is airing more than 100 hours of mental health-related programming throughout September. 

Advertisement

The network’s series America’s Breakdown: Confronting Our Mental Health Crisis will broadcast personal mental health stories, education and resources, according to an Aug. 31 release from Newsy.

All the network’s coverage will be available free on the company’s website after airing.
